2025
  • Organic Champion: The Honorable Russell Redding, Pennsylvania Secretary of Agriculture
  • Organic Lifetime Achievement: Albert Straus, Straus Family Creamery; and David Lively, Organically Grown Company  
  • Organic Farmers of the Year: Chris and Marcie Baugher, Baugher Ranch Organics
  • Organic Environmental Leadership: Charlotte Vallaeys, Principal, Vallaeys Consulting LLC    
  • Organic Trailblazer: Nicole Atchison, CEO, PURIS
  • Organic Social Impact: Tony Bedard, CEO, Frontier Co-op

2024
  • Organic Lifetime Achievement: George Siemon, Organic Valley
  • Organic Champion: The Honorable Jenny Lester Moffitt, U.S. Department of Agriculture
  • Organic Groundbreaker: Mac Ehrhardt, Albert Lea Seed
  • Organic Farmer of the Year: Larry Santos, Taylor Farming
  • Organic Climate Action: Renaud des Rosiers, Amy's Kitchen
  • Social Impact: Jyoti Stephens, Nature’s Path
